Frames per second, this is the number of still photographs the camera takes every second that when played make the video. The higher the fps the better the camera will be at capturing fast movement in detail with out bluring.

Which camcorder Accessories can I use to plug my camcorder into my t.v.?

To connect your camcorder to your television, use an camcorder audio/video cable. They are the three-part cables with the red, yellow and white connectors.


Can a JVC Everio GZ MS120 record 240fps?

No, the JVC Everio GZ-MS120 does not support recording at 240 frames per second (fps). This camcorder typically records at standard frame rates, such as 30fps or 60fps, depending on the settings. For high-frame-rate recording like 240fps, you would need a different model or a camcorder specifically designed for high-speed video capture.
